What is the difference between Manager Financial Planning Analysis vs Financial Analyst?

AspectManager Financial Planning AnalysisFinancial Analyst
ResponsibilitiesOversees budgeting, forecasting, and strategic financial planning; manages teams and develops financial modelsPerforms data analysis, prepares reports, and supports budgeting processes
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or related field; often MBA or CPA preferredBachelor's degree in finance, economics, or related field; certifications like CFA are common
Work EnvironmentCorporate finance departments, often in larger organizationsFinancial services firms, corporations, or consulting firms

While both roles require strong financial analysis skills and relevant credentials, the Manager Financial Planning Analysis typically leads teams and handles strategic planning, whereas the Financial Analyst focuses on data analysis and reporting to support decision-making.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ager financial planning analysis,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Manager Financial Planning Analysis, you need strong analytical skills, advanced knowledge of financial modeling, and a background in finance or accounting, typically supported by a bachelor’s or master’s degree and often a CPA or CFA certification. Expertise in financial planning software such as Hyperion, SAP, or Oracle, and advanced proficiency in Excel, are essential technical requirements. Excellent le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ills help build effective teams and convey complex financial insights to stakeholders. These skills and qualities are crucial for driving strategic decision-making, ensuring accurate forecasting, and supporting organizational financial health.

What is a manager financial planning analysis?

A Manager of Financial Planning and Analysis (FP&A) is responsible for overseeing a company's budgeting, forecasting, and financial analysis processes. They work closely with senior management to provide insights that drive business decisions, improve financial performance, and support strategic planning. This role typically involves analyzing financial data, preparing reports, and presenting recommendations to leadership. FP&A managers also help identify trends, risks, and opportunities to ensure the organization's financial health.

How does a manager financial planning analysis typically collaborate with other departments to support business decision-making?

A Manager of Financial Planning and Analysis (FP&A) works closely with various departments such as operations, sales, and marketing to gather data and insights that inform financial forecasts and budgets. They facilitate cross-functional meetings to understand business needs, align financial strategies, and provide actionable recommendations. Effective communication with department heads ensures that financial plans are realistic and support overall organizational goals. This collaborative approach helps drive informed business decisions and strengthens the company’s financial performance.

The Experience

The Finance & Strategy (F&S) team is a global organization responsible for delivering financial predictability and control, business accountability, insight to optimize decisions and resources, and shareholder success.
We are seeking a Manager to join the Corporate F&S Revenue team focusing on revenue forecasting, metrics, and reporting. This role partners closely across the F&S organization: F&S Go To Market (GTM), F&S Product, F&S Corporate and the Controllership organization to deliver accurate financial forecasting and insights. The role requires strong top-line forecasting skills coupled with a high degree of internal customer interaction across the broader finance organization.
What You'll Actually Be Doing

  • Own revenue forecast for a cloud and deliver high degree of forecast accuracy

  • Deliver revenue insights, explain revenue trends and forecast variances

  • Prepare impactful presentations that deliver messages clearly and engages audience.

  • Work closely with broader F&S Corporate team, F&S GTM, F&S Product and Controllership to understand impact of related processes on revenue results and forecast.

  • Partner closely with Corporate F&S counterparts on delivering short-term revenue forecast, highlighting risks & opportunities, and aligning on current remaining performance obligations (cRPO) and long-range revenue

  • Partner with Investor Relations providing insights related to external narrative.

  • Continuously improve the quality and accessibility of our data. Utilize data and data visualization skills to make processes and reporting more efficient.

  • Develop models and data solutions to contribute to achieving company's strategy and goals.

  • Identify opportunities and implement automated solutions including use of artificial intelligence and machine learning.


You're Our Person If...

  • Extensive experience in Financial Planning & Analysis or a combination of Financial Planning & Analysis, Revenue Accounting or Financial Audit.

  • Substantial experience building and maintaining complex financial models

  • Strong communication, reporting, storytelling and presentation skills. Ability to building and maintaining relationships.

  • Ability to multi-task effectively in a fast-paced, quickly changing environment.

  • Self-starter who can navigate through ambiguity while aligning with business partners.

  • Use of Artificial Intelligence in dailywork

  • Growth mindset & adaptable

Even Better If...

  • Knowledge of software revenue recognition under ASC 606

  • Data & Analytics: advanced Snowflake/SQL, Tableau, Hyperion skills

This role is hybrid and goes into the office 3 days per week.
